  • << <i>What is the turn time on the Ryan Foundation auto?
    I would like to add a Ryan auto to my auto'd baseball collection >>



    Check out the web site. They have a phone number and email address you can contact them.

    They will tell you roughly when they expect the next signing to be. The last one was in early December. They told me I would get it back before christmas. I did 2 days early.

    You can also buy photo's, balls and I believe jersey's that they have in their shop already signed.
